The School of Music is searching for a Marketing Assistant. This is a part-time temporary position to work during this academic year, perfect for someone with marketing and communications experience, who thrives in an academic work environment, and has a passion for music! This position will be responsible for working closely with the Director of Marketing & Communications within the School of Music to prepare materials, work on newsletters, and provide administrative support.
Your core responsibilities will include:
- Preparing program books for School of Music performances, which includes gathering content for each book from performer(s), laying out and proofreading the program using a template, and sending the program to be printed
- Researching and writing content for electronic newsletters
- Crafting and updating event listings on various platforms, and ensuring accurate information is listed for each event
- Answering phones, taking messages and providing routine information and answers to questions
- Filing, both hard copy as well as electronic documents.
- Generating (i.e., types, word processes, etc.) materials such as emails, standardized forms, form letters, labels, lists and routine memos and letters as well as reports and manuscripts
- May make deliveries to other offices on campus. Opens, date stamps and distributes mail to appropriate person
